プロが教えるわが家の防犯対策術!

現在DNSの勉強の為、2台のPCをサーバとクライアントとして
設定を行っています。
参考書等調べながらやっていますが、うまくいきません。

状況:
DNSの設定を行いサーバ本体でnslookupやdigで確認すると正引き、
逆引き共にIPアドレス、ホスト名を返してきます。
そこで次にクライアント側でdigを行うと下記を返してきて、うまくいきません。

;; connection timed out ; no servers could be reached

Q.クライアントのPCより名前解決できるようにしたいのですが、
  ご参考意見がございましたら教えて頂ければと思い質問致しま
  した。

サーバ側
OS Fedora Core5
プライベートIPアドレス
192.168.1.2
ホスト名
linux.ittest.com
DNSサーバ BIND
※DHCPサーバも稼動

クライアント側
Debian 3.1 sarge
プライベートIPアドレス
192.168.1.10
DHCPでIP取得

クライアント側の「/etc/resolv.conf」は下記設定としてます。
search ittest.com(ドメイン名)
nameserver 192.168.1.2(DNSサーバーIPアドレス)

またDNSの「/etc/named.conf」は既存のファイルに下記を加えました。
zone "ittest.com" IN{
type master;
file "ittest.com.db";
allow-update { none; };
};
zone "1.168.192.in-addr.arpa" IN {
type master;
file "1.168.192.in-addr.arpa.db";
allow-update{ none; };
};

ゾーンファイルは下記を作成しました。
/var/named/ittest.com.db作成

$TTL 86400
ittest.com. IN SOA linux.itteste.com. root.ittest.com. (
2007103100;Serial
7200;Refresh
3600;Retry
604800;Expire
86400;Minimum TTL
)
INNS linux.ittest.com
INMX 10linux
linuxINA192.168.1.2
INMX 10linux
wwwINCNAMElinux

-------------------------------------------
/var/named/1.168.192.in-addr.arpa.db作成

$TTL 86400
1.168.192.in-addr.arpa. IN SOA linux.ittest.com. root.ittest.com. (
2007103100;Serial
7200;Refresh
3600;Retry
604800;Expire
86400;Minimum TTL
)
INNSlinux.ittest.com
2INPTRlinux.ittest.com

※PINGは通っています。

長くなりまた質問内容が的確ではないかも知れませんが、
アドバイスの方頂けたらと思います。

A 回答 (1件)

念のため、


$ dig example.co.jp @<DNSIP>
として、応答が返ってくるかどうかを確認してください。
("example.co.jp"には適当なホスト名を、<DNSIP>にはDNSサーバのIPアドレスを入れてください)
それでも期待する応答が得られないのであれば、named.conf内の"option" で、listen-on が 127.0.0.1 に制限されている、なんてことはないですか?

named.confの内容を確認することをお奨めします。
    • good
    • 0
この回答へのお礼

Toshi0230様
早速のご回答ありがとうございます。

申し訳ございません、ポートの問題でした。
名前解決はできるようになりました。
しかしながら「named.conf」の内容の確認は続けていこうと思います。

また何かございましたらよろしくお願いします。

お礼日時:2007/11/01 18:07

お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!